Neutral Citation No. - 2025:AHC-LKO:794-DB Court No. - 1 Case :- WRIT - C No. - 27 of 2025 Petitioner :- Nirmala Respondent :- State Of U.P. Thru.Its Acs/Prin. Secy. Deptt. Revenue Govt. Of U.P. Lko. And 5 Others Counsel for Petitioner :- Manuvendra Singh,Pawan Kumar Tiwari Counsel for Respondent :- C.S.C.,Mohan Singh Hon'ble Attau Rahman Masoodi,J. Hon'ble Subhash Vidyarthi,J. 1. The learned Standing Counsel appearing on behalf of the State submits that the petitioner has a statutory remedy of filing an application under Rule 59 of the Revenue Code Rules, which she has not availed. 2. Accordingly, writ petition is dismissed with liberty to the petitioner to avail appropriate remedy available her under law. Order Date :- 6.1.2025 Pradeep/- Digitally signed by :- PRADEEP SINGH High Court of Judicature at Allahabad, Lucknow Bench
